Instructions
Instructions
In a small bowl, stir together 1/4 cup butter (melted) and 1 teaspoon cinnamon until combined; set aside.
In a separate small bowl, whisk 1/2 cup powdered sugar with 1 tablespoon half & half until smooth and pourable (drizzling consistency). If needed, whisk briskly or warm briefly to loosen; set aside.
Place 2 tablespoons vegetable oil or canola oil and 1/2 cup popcorn kernels into a large pot. Add a few dashes of salt. Cover the pot with a tight-fitting lid or foil.
Place the pot over medium-high heat. Hold the lid and shake the pot back and forth over the burner occasionally so kernels heat evenly. When kernels begin to pop, continue shaking the pot gently.
When popping slows to several seconds between pops (about a minute or two after it starts), remove the pot from the heat.
Immediately dump the hot popcorn onto a baking sheet or into a large bowl. Drizzle the cinnamon butter over the popcorn and stir or toss to coat evenly.
Drizzle the powdered sugar glaze over the coated popcorn and toss gently to distribute. Serve warm, or let cool on the baking sheet so the glaze can harden slightly.
